An exciting opportunity for applicants with a background in CMM Operation and/or Programming to join a growing business based near Barnoldswick, Lancashire.
A leading manufacturer of precision-engineered components based near Barnoldswick are looking to recruit a CMM Operator / Programmer to join their growing CMM & Quality team. This is a full-time, permanent position that will be based on-site.
